# Monthly partitioning constants — Granary storage layer.
# Plugins must route writes by partition key; cross-month writes are
# rejected. Retention and pre-creation windows are fixed here, not
# configurable per plugin. Querying a dropped partition returns empty,
# not an error. The governing constants are listed below.

tuning table, fawip-fahag:
WEIGHTS = {
    "novwyn": 452,
    "casdor": 675,
}

Exports — Tabulith onboarding

Spreadsheet exports were OOMing on sheets over 200k rows. We now stream rows through Quillfort instead of buffering. Memory is flat at ~80MB per export worker. One gotcha: streaming uploads to the Quillfort store require an auth credential in your .env. Add this line before running exports locally.

vault entry, yahif-yajep: COURIER_KEY29=b802bdf8034096b65a51c6ba5abe2

During log compaction, the Quillstream broker opens a short-lived compaction session per partition. Sessions are pinned to the coordinator and renewed every 45 seconds; a missed renewal aborts compaction safely, leaving segments intact. Note for this week's sync: we reduced session TTL from 120s to 60s after the Harrowgate incident, which cut orphaned lock time by half. Compaction metrics now tag session IDs for tracing. To replay the staging scenario yourself, authenticate with the token below.

session JWT of yawep-yawep = eyJhbGciOiJIUzI1NiIsInR5cCI6IkpXVCJ9.eyJzdWIiOiI3pWF3_In0.aXYsHiog